Output 83aed4263ef43dcc8fdc0fb741ec325c0f02e84e6700e4e8f6fca523ae93f9a7:42

value
5066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2015b5d3fa478d1cc4dfce3af527098774161f76 OP_EQUAL
address
34cfZ8xcYjaCkYw6wD4GqLL6GSrXgvpYEo
transaction
83aed4263ef43dcc8fdc0fb741ec325c0f02e84e6700e4e8f6fca523ae93f9a7
spent
false